fyrmedik Posted July 6, 2012 #1 Share Posted July 6, 2012 Hello, everyone, My family is flying into SEATAC airport tomorrow, to get ready for our Vancouver departure on Monday. We leave SEATAC Monday morning via Princess bus, which will shuttle us to the Vancouver pier. My wife and I made this same trip two years ago. What we cannot remember for sure is, was there some contact with a Princess representative when we arrived at the airport? Something I read when I entered our flight information made me think that someone was supposed to meet us when we landed on Saturday, but neither of us can remember this particular detail of our last trip. I do know that we have to meet Princess on the baggage floor atrium area to board the bus on Monday. Can anyone jog our memory on the arrival details, please? Dan G Posted July 6, 2012 #2 Share Posted July 6, 2012 normally you will see a "Princess" rep in baggage claim. The charter buses all load from door 00 near baggage carousel 1 in baggage claim. You will see your rep or if you go where the buses are there is a princess desk.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
